Frequently asked questions

Are king mattress protectors waterproof?

Most king mattress protectors are waterproof or water-resistant. Waterproof protectors use a membrane to block liquids, while water-resistant ones repel spills to some degree. Check product specs for your needs.

Do mattress protectors affect comfort?

Quality protectors are designed to be noiseless and breathable, so they minimally affect comfort. Cotton or bamboo models often enhance breathability, while wool may add firmness. Always look for soft, fitted designs.

How often should I wash a mattress protector?

Wash your mattress protector every one to two months, or more frequently if you have allergies or spills. Use gentle detergent and avoid bleach. Follow the care label for drying instructions.

What certifications should I look for?

CertiPUR-US ensures foam is free of harmful chemicals. OEKO-TEX Standard 100 certifies no harmful substances in fabric. Both add safety assurance. Many protectors carry one or both.

Will a mattress protector fit a thick mattress?

Many protectors have deep pockets up to 18 inches. Measure your mattress depth and check product specs. Some models offer extra stretch or straps for a secure fit on thicker mattresses.
